Hi,
I’m doing some tests with the board RB133 (forum topic: rb133 boot issue).
I want to use wireless mini PCI card MB82 (MB82 specification). Regarding to information I found on internet the module ath9k should support this wifi card. But there is something wrong during booting process I can't understand. Module mac80211 could not be loaded, there are unknown symbols. Searching through the forum I found some topics regarding missing symbols and it could be due to incompatibility of module and the kernel. But I don't know how to solve it.
[ 0.000000] Linux version 3.18.43 (taczanowski@taczanowski) (gcc version 5.4.0 (LEDE GCC 5.4.0 r2993+893-b9a408c2b4) ) #0 Mon May 14 08:29:20 2018
[ 0.000000] bootconsole [early0] enabled
[ 0.000000] CPU0 revision is: 0001800b (MIPS 4Kc)
[ 0.000000] SoC : ADM5120 rev 8, running at 175.000 MHz
[ 0.000000] Bootdev : NAND flash
[ 0.000000] Prom : RouterBOOT
[ 0.000000] Determined physical RAM map:
[ 0.000000] memory: 02000000 @ 00000000 (usable)
[ 0.000000] Initrd not found or empty - disabling initrd
[ 0.000000] Zone ranges:
[ 0.000000] Normal [mem 0x00000000-0x01ffffff]
[ 0.000000] Movable zone start for each node
[ 0.000000] Early memory node ranges
[ 0.000000] node 0: [mem 0x00000000-0x01ffffff]
[ 0.000000] Initmem setup node 0 [mem 0x00000000-0x01ffffff]
[ 0.000000] On node 0 totalpages: 8192
[ 0.000000] free_area_init_node: node 0, pgdat 80348960, node_mem_map 81000000
[ 0.000000] Normal zone: 64 pages used for memmap
[ 0.000000] Normal zone: 0 pages reserved
[ 0.000000] Normal zone: 8192 pages, LIFO batch:0
[ 0.000000] Primary instruction cache 8kB, VIPT, 2-way, linesize 16 bytes.
[ 0.000000] Primary data cache 8kB, 2-way, VIPT, no aliases, linesize 16 bytes
[ 0.000000] pcpu-alloc: s0 r0 d32768 u32768 alloc=1*32768
[ 0.000000] pcpu-alloc: [0] 0
[ 0.000000] Built 1 zonelists in Zone order, mobility grouping on. Total pages: 8128
[ 0.000000] Kernel command line: console=ttyAM0,115200 rootfstype=yaffs2
[ 0.000000] PID hash table entries: 128 (order: -3, 512 bytes)
[ 0.000000] Dentry cache hash table entries: 4096 (order: 2, 16384 bytes)
[ 0.000000] Inode-cache hash table entries: 2048 (order: 1, 8192 bytes)
[ 0.000000] Memory: 28648K/32768K available (2708K kernel code, 112K rwdata, 612K rodata, 140K init, 190K bss, 4120K reserved)
[ 0.000000] NR_IRQS:24
[ 0.036000] Calibrating delay loop... 173.05 BogoMIPS (lpj=346112)
[ 0.040000] pid_max: default: 32768 minimum: 301
[ 0.044000] Mount-cache hash table entries: 1024 (order: 0, 4096 bytes)
[ 0.048000] Mountpoint-cache hash table entries: 1024 (order: 0, 4096 bytes)
[ 0.076000] NET: Registered protocol family 16
[ 0.084000] MIPS: machine is Mikrotik RouterBOARD 133
[ 0.092000] registering PCI controller with io_map_base unset
[ 0.132000] PCI host bridge to bus 0000:00
[ 0.136000] pci_bus 0000:00: root bus resource [mem 0x11400000-0x114fffff]
[ 0.140000] pci_bus 0000:00: root bus resource [io 0x11500000-0x115fffef]
[ 0.144000] pci_bus 0000:00: No busn resource found for root bus, will use [bus 00-ff]
[ 0.148000] pci 0000:00:00.0: [1317:5120] type 00 class 0x060000
[ 0.148000] pci 0000:00:00.0: reg 0x10: [mem 0xf0000000-0xffffffff]
[ 0.148000] pci 0000:00:01.0: [168c:0027] type 00 class 0x028000
[ 0.148000] pci 0000:00:01.0: reg 0x10: [mem 0x00000000-0x0000ffff]
[ 0.148000] pci 0000:00:01.0: PME# supported from D0 D3hot
[ 0.152000] pci_bus 0000:00: busn_res: [bus 00-ff] end is updated to 00
[ 0.152000] pci 0000:00:01.0: BAR 0: assigned [mem 0x11400000-0x1140ffff]
[ 0.156000] PCI: mapping irq for 0000:00:01.0 pin:1, irq:14
[ 0.164000] Switched to clocksource MIPS
[ 0.180000] NET: Registered protocol family 2
[ 0.188000] TCP established hash table entries: 1024 (order: 0, 4096 bytes)
[ 0.196000] TCP bind hash table entries: 1024 (order: 0, 4096 bytes)
[ 0.204000] TCP: Hash tables configured (established 1024 bind 1024)
[ 0.208000] TCP: reno registered
[ 0.212000] UDP hash table entries: 256 (order: 0, 4096 bytes)
[ 0.220000] UDP-Lite hash table entries: 256 (order: 0, 4096 bytes)
[ 0.228000] NET: Registered protocol family 1
[ 0.232000] PCI: CLS 16 bytes, default 16
[ 0.252000] futex hash table entries: 256 (order: -1, 3072 bytes)
[ 0.272000] yaffs: yaffs Installing.
[ 0.272000] msgmni has been set to 55
[ 0.284000] io scheduler noop registered
[ 0.288000] io scheduler deadline registered (default)
[ 0.712000] Serial: AMBA driver
[ 0.716000] apb:uart0: ttyAM0 at MMIO 0x12600000 (irq = 9, base_baud = 0) is a AMBA
[ 0.724000] console [ttyAM0] enabled
[ 0.732000] bootconsole [early0] disabled
[ 0.744000] apb:uart1: ttyAM1 at MMIO 0x12800000 (irq = 10, base_baud = 0) is a AMBA
[ 0.756000] adm5120-flash.0: probing at 0x1FC00000, size:128KiB, width:8 bits
[ 0.764000] Found: PMC Pm39LV010
[ 0.768000] adm5120-flash.0: Found 1 x8 devices at 0x0 in 8-bit bank
[ 0.776000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x20000
[ 0.776000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x40000
[ 0.776000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x60000
[ 0.776000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x80000
[ 0.776000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0xa0000
[ 0.776000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0xc0000
[ 0.776000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0xe0000
[ 0.776000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x100000
[ 0.776000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x120000
[ 0.776000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x140000
[ 0.776000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x160000
[ 0.776000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x180000
[ 0.776000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x1a0000
[ 0.776000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x1c0000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x1e0000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x200000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x220000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x240000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x260000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x280000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x2a0000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x2c0000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x2e0000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x300000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x320000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x340000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x360000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x380000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x3a0000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x3c0000
[ 0.780000] adm5120-flash.0: Found different chip or no chip at all (mfr 0xff, id 0xff) at 0x3e0000
[ 0.780000] number of JEDEC chips: 1
[ 0.784000] adm5120-flash.0: found at 0x1FC00000, size:128KiB, width:8 bits
[ 0.792000] Creating 2 MTD partitions on "adm5120-flash.0":
[ 0.796000] 0x000000000000-0x000000010000 : "booter"
[ 0.812000] 0x000000010000-0x000000020000 : "firmware"
[ 0.824000] nand: device found, Manufacturer ID: 0xad, Chip ID: 0x76
[ 0.832000] nand: Hynix NAND 64MiB 3,3V 8-bit
[ 0.836000] nand: 64MiB, SLC, page size: 512, OOB size: 16
[ 0.840000] Scanning device for bad blocks
[ 1.176000] Creating 2 MTD partitions on "gen_nand":
[ 1.180000] 0x000000000000-0x000000400000 : "kernel"
[ 1.192000] 0x000000400000-0x000004000000 : "rootfs"
[ 1.212000] mtd: device 3 (rootfs) set to be root filesystem
[ 1.216000] ADM5120 built-in ethernet switch driver version 0.1.1
[ 1.256000] adm5120_wdt: Watchdog Timer version 0.1
[ 1.260000] TCP: cubic registered
[ 1.268000] NET: Registered protocol family 10
[ 1.388000] NET: Registered protocol family 17
[ 1.392000] bridge: automatic filtering via arp/ip/ip6tables has been deprecated. Update your scripts to load br_netfilter if you need this.
[ 1.404000] 8021q: 802.1Q VLAN Support v1.8
[ 2.096000] yaffs: dev is 32505859 name is "mtdblock3" ro
[ 2.104000] yaffs: passed flags ""
[ 2.104000] yaffs: yaffs: Attempting MTD mount of 31.3,"mtdblock3"
[ 2.104000] yaffs: auto selecting yaffs1
[ 9.972000] yaffs: yaffs_read_super: is_checkpointed 0
[ 9.972000] VFS: Mounted root (yaffs2 filesystem) readonly on device 31:3.
[ 9.980000] Freeing unused kernel memory: 140K (8035d000 - 80380000)
[ 11.156000] init: Console is alive
[ 11.160000] adm5120_wdt: enabling watchdog timer
[ 11.164000] init: - watchdog -
[ 12.760000] kmodloader: loading kernel modules from /etc/modules-boot.d/*
[ 12.816000] Button Hotplug driver version 0.4.1
[ 12.852000] input: gpio-keys-polled as /devices/platform/gpio-keys-polled/input/input0
[ 12.864000] kmodloader: done loading kernel modules from /etc/modules-boot.d/*
[ 12.888000] init: - preinit -
[ 13.608000] random: procd urandom read with 53 bits of entropy available
[ 17.280000] mount_root: mounting /dev/root
[ 17.304000] urandom-seed: Seeding with /etc/urandom.seed
[ 17.540000] procd: - early -
[ 17.544000] procd: - watchdog -
[ 21.588000] procd: - watchdog -
[ 21.596000] procd: - ubus -
[ 21.676000] procd: - init -
[ 23.108000] kmodloader: loading kernel modules from /etc/modules.d/*
[ 23.256000] Initializing XFRM netlink socket
[ 23.272000] NET: Registered protocol family 15
[ 23.288000] tun: Universal TUN/TAP device driver, 1.6
[ 23.292000] tun: (C) 1999-2004 Max Krasnyansky <maxk@qualcomm.com>
[ 23.368000] ipip: IPv4 over IPv4 tunneling driver
[ 23.552000] l2tp_core: L2TP core driver, V2.0
[ 23.564000] l2tp_netlink: L2TP netlink interface
[ 23.588000] IPv4 over IPsec tunneling driver
[ 23.644000] gre: GRE over IPv4 demultiplexor driver
[ 23.660000] ip_gre: GRE over IPv4 tunneling driver
[ 23.740000] ip6_tables: (C) 2000-2006 Netfilter Core Team
[ 23.836000] Loading modules backported from Linux version wt-2017-01-31-0-ge882dff19e7f
[ 23.848000] Backport generated by backports.git backports-20160324-13-g24da7d3c
[ 24.408000] mac80211: Unknown symbol backport_crypto_alloc_skcipher (err 0)
[ 24.560000] mac80211: Unknown symbol backport_crypto_alloc_skcipher (err 0)
[ 24.716000] mac80211: Unknown symbol backport_crypto_alloc_skcipher (err 0)
[ 24.916000] mac80211: Unknown symbol backport_crypto_alloc_skcipher (err 0)
[ 25.284000] ip_tables: (C) 2000-2006 Netfilter Core Team
[ 25.552000] mac80211: Unknown symbol backport_crypto_alloc_skcipher (err 0)
[ 25.664000] nf_conntrack version 0.5.0 (449 buckets, 1796 max)
[ 25.948000] xt_time: kernel timezone is -0000
[ 26.124000] mac80211: Unknown symbol backport_crypto_alloc_skcipher (err 0)
[ 26.308000] PPP generic driver version 2.4.2
[ 26.348000] PPP MPPE Compression module registered
[ 26.368000] NET: Registered protocol family 24
[ 26.416000] l2tp_ppp: PPPoL2TP kernel driver, V2.0
[ 26.548000] mac80211: Unknown symbol backport_crypto_alloc_skcipher (err 0)
[ 26.692000] mac80211: Unknown symbol backport_crypto_alloc_skcipher (err 0)
[ 26.740000] kmodloader: 5 modules could not be probed
[ 26.748000] kmodloader: dependency not loaded mac80211
[ 26.756000] kmodloader: - ath10k_core - 1
[ 26.764000] kmodloader: dependency not loaded ath10k_core
[ 26.772000] kmodloader: - ath10k_pci - 1
[ 26.780000] kmodloader: dependency not loaded mac80211
[ 26.788000] kmodloader: - ath5k - 1
[ 26.796000] kmodloader: dependency not loaded mac80211
[ 26.804000] kmodloader: - ath9k - 1
[ 26.812000] kmodloader: - mac80211 - 0
[ 35.340000] random: nonblocking pool is initialized
[ 72.568000] device eth0 entered promiscuous mode
[ 72.608000] br-lan: port 1(eth0) entered forwarding state
[ 72.612000] br-lan: port 1(eth0) entered forwarding state
[ 74.616000] br-lan: port 1(eth0) entered forwarding state
I tried image from jtaczanowski and some other my compilations but always with the same result.
Anybody can help?
Thanx